Why South Brooksville Homes Face Plumbing Surprises

If you live in South Brooksville, you already know this area has its quirks. Many homes here were built decades ago, which means they often rely on outdated plumbing systems. Aging pipes, corroded fittings, and outdated materials can lead to unexpected leaks, clogs, or even complete system failures. Add in Florida's heavy rainfall and storm season, and you have a recipe for sudden plumbing emergencies.

We’ve seen everything from water heaters blowing out during summer storms to sewer backups after days of heavy rain. Our team knows how to handle these situations fast and professionally. FAQs: Emergency Plumbing in South Brooksville

What qualifies as a plumbing emergency?

Flooding, water loss, clogged sewer lines, and anything that can cause structural damage or health risks should be treated as an emergency.

What can I do before the plumber gets here?

If it's safe, shut off your main water valve. If you're not sure how, give us a call and we'll guide you through it over the phone.

Tips for Homeowners in South Brooksville

  • Make sure your gutters and downspouts are clear before storm season. Blocked gutters can cause water to overflow and seep into your foundation, leading to long-term structural damage.
  • Know where your water shutoff valve is and test it twice a year. A quick shutoff in an emergency can reduce water damage significantly and give you peace of mind.
  • Never pour grease down the drain; use a sealed container instead. Grease solidifies in pipes and is one of the top causes of kitchen drain clogs, which are costly to fix.
  • Don’t ignore slow drains; they often lead to bigger problems. A slow drain can signal deeper blockages or deteriorating pipes that need immediate attention.
  • Install a water alarm under your water heater for early leak detection. These small devices can alert you before a minor leak turns into a major flood, saving you thousands in repairs.

Taking these preventive steps now can protect your home, prevent emergencies, and help you avoid unexpected repair bills.
